Pistachio and Herb Salmon

This is my favorite salmon recipe. Simple too! Chopped Pistachios, lemon juice 3 TBLS, Honey 1TBLS, Dry Dill 1 TSP, I added a little pesto that I had on hand but that is optional. Salt and pepper.
